199:(UPMC). In her early years as chief, she led studies that found more children developed disabilities than those a decade ago, with the increase predominantly occurring in middle-class families. Three years after her appointment, Houtrow was named to the pediatric standing committee for the National Quality Forum pediatric measurement endorsement project. In 2017, she found that the development of asthma, attention deficit hyperactivity disorder, and autism spectrum disorder were directly influenced by poverty status. 31: 214:
